Declaring CNN and Twitter as an “enemy of America,” and proclaiming “Communist Democrats can't stop the truth,” Rep. Marjorie Taylor Greene (R-GA) denounced her permanent banishment from Twitter. The ban occurred just hours after she published a tweet, falsely suggesting there have been “extremely high amounts of Covid vaccine-related deaths.” Twitter cited a “strike” system for violations of its COVID policy, which bars users from sharing content that is “demonstrably false or misleading and may lead to a significant risk of harm.” Five or more strikes lead to a permanent suspension.
